Madonna, Andrew Darnell: Couple SPLIT after ‘five months’

Madonna and Andrew Darnell are not together anymore.

After dating for less than a year, Madonna and her model boyfriend Andrew Darnell, who is 41 years her junior, reportedly called it quits.

The Material Girl singer, 64, is going through a "crisis of confidence" due to their divorce and recent criticism of her appearance earlier this month that was "ageist and misogynistic."

'It was only a very casual thing [with Darnell] so she’s not broken-hearted. It’s just that it has come at a bad time,' a source told Page Six on Friday.

The insider added, 'She’s having a bit of a crisis of confidence and this doesn’t help. She had a lot of fun with Andrew but it was never love or anything like that.'

The pair started dating just after her three-year relationship with former backup dancer Ahlamalik Williams, 28, ended.

She was initially romantically associated with Darnell in September after they were seen kissing at a gathering in New York City.

'They were definitely smooching,' Page Six reported at the time. 'She and Andrew were being very openly affectionate all night, snuggling and cuddling in the booth.'

Why Madonna separated from Andrew Darnell

Haters complaining on social media that she didn't recognise herself at the 2023 Grammy Awards allegedly shaken her self-esteem.

In reaction to criticism, the mother of six stated that a "long lens camera" had caused her face to appear puffier than it was during the presentation.

'Once again I am caught in the glare of ageism and misogyny that permeates the world we live in,' she wrote on her Instagram Story.
